A Professional Certificate in Negotiation for Contract Compliance equips professionals with the essential skills to navigate complex contract negotiations and ensure compliance. The program focuses on practical application, allowing participants to confidently handle contract disputes and maintain strong business relationships.
Learning outcomes include mastering negotiation strategies, understanding contract law fundamentals, and developing effective communication techniques for conflict resolution. Participants will learn to identify potential risks within contracts and implement mitigation strategies. This contract compliance training is designed to boost confidence and efficiency in contract management.
The program's duration typically ranges from several weeks to a few months, depending on the chosen format (online, in-person, or hybrid). This flexible timeframe accommodates professionals' busy schedules while delivering comprehensive learning experiences.
This certificate holds significant industry relevance across various sectors, including legal, procurement, sales, and project management. Mastering contract negotiation techniques enhances career prospects and increases efficiency in managing contractual obligations. The program's focus on dispute resolution and risk management is highly valued by employers.
Graduates of a Professional Certificate in Negotiation for Contract Compliance demonstrate expertise in contract review, negotiation tactics, and compliance procedures, making them invaluable assets within their organizations. The skills acquired are directly applicable to real-world scenarios, impacting bottom lines and strengthening organizational resilience.

Why this course?
A Professional Certificate in Negotiation is increasingly significant for ensuring contract compliance in today’s complex UK business landscape. The rising cost of contract disputes and breaches necessitates skilled negotiators. According to a recent study by the Chartered Institute of Procurement & Supply (CIPS), 65% of UK businesses experienced at least one significant contract dispute in the last year, resulting in an average cost of £50,000 per dispute. This highlights the growing need for professionals adept at proactive negotiation and conflict resolution to mitigate these losses. Effective negotiation skills, honed through structured training, enable individuals to secure favourable terms, prevent breaches, and minimize financial risks associated with non-compliance. This is particularly crucial in sectors like construction, IT and procurement, where contract complexities are high.
